Meaning
Biopharmaceutical prepacked chromatography columns are essential components of bioprocessing workflows, enabling the purification and separation of biomolecules such as proteins, antibodies, nucleic acids, and vaccines. These columns consist of a column body filled with chromatography media, including resins, beads, or membranes, designed to selectively capture, separate, and purify target molecules from complex biological mixtures. Prepacked chromatography columns eliminate the need for column packing and preparation, saving time, labor, and resources in biopharmaceutical manufacturing processes.

Category-wise Insight
- Affinity chromatography: Affinity chromatography columns utilize specific ligands or binding agents to selectively capture and purify target biomolecules based on their affinity for the chromatography media, enabling high-purity isolation of proteins, antibodies, and other biomolecules.
- Ion exchange chromatography: Ion exchange chromatography columns separate biomolecules based on their charge properties, allowing the purification of proteins, nucleic acids, and viruses through interactions with charged functional groups on the chromatography media.
- Size exclusion chromatography: Size exclusion chromatography columns separate biomolecules based on their size and molecular weight, enabling the purification of proteins, viruses, and nucleic acids by excluding larger molecules and retaining smaller ones.
- Hydrophobic interaction chromatography: Hydrophobic interaction chromatography columns separate biomolecules based on their hydrophobic properties, allowing the purification of proteins, antibodies, and other hydrophobic molecules through interactions with the hydrophobic ligands on the chromatography media.
